2. Choose the Right Digital Mediums for Your Business’ Objectives 


If you’re already using digital marketing or thinking about using it to grow your business, that’s a great start! However, you need to make sure you’re using the right platforms, since certain platforms might make more sense for your business than others depending on your objectives. 


For instance, are you looking to
increase awareness for your business? Display ads, email marketing, and geofencing would be great options thanks to being visually impactful and timely. Looking to engage your audience of potential customers? Social media advertising including branded content, social media posts, YouTube Ads, and Facebook Ads would be excellent choices. 


If your aim is to
convert consumers who are already in the market and searching for products or services like yours, search engine marketing (SEM) is the way to go.

4. Leverage Targeting Capabilities to Reach the Right Audiences and Receive a Greater ROI 


Knowing who your target audience is and being aware of the best platforms to reach them on is vital to any successful digital marketing campaign. Unlike traditional marketing methods, the ability to target specific consumers is arguably digital marketing’s biggest advantage.


By reaching the right people at the right time, you can rest assured that your marketing spend is being utilized as effectively and efficiently as possible. For instance, if you own an auto dealership, you would want to reach consumers who are actively in the market for their next vehicle. Thanks to digital marketing targeting capabilities, your business could specifically show ads to these consumers. 


Have a specific vehicle in mind? You can even narrow your target audience down to the consumers who would be most interested. If you have an SUV vehicle model you’re wanting to promote, you could reach auto intenders based on if they have children, what their household income is, their interests, and more. 


This is just one example, and most businesses can benefit from the targeting capabilities that digital marketing services have to offer.

6. Optimize, Optimize, Optimize! 


Optimizing your marketing campaigns over time plays a crucial role in getting the business results you’re looking for. Essentially, optimizing your campaigns means setting them up for success by seeing what works and what doesn’t -- and adjusting accordingly. 


For instance, a digital marketing campaign might have major results from social media marketing across Facebook and Instagram in one month, but might not see as strong of results on other platforms that same month. 


In order to optimize for the next month, it would be wise to continue with the successful social media platforms and/or increase the social media marketing budget, while reallocating some of the budget away from the platforms that did not perform as well. 


Over time, businesses can see dramatic results from paying close attention to what works best for their goals and taking the time to optimize and strategize ongoingly.



7. Consider Multicultural Marketing to Connect with Multicultural Consumers


Many businesses make the mistake of failing to reach multicultural consumers by thinking that their general market strategy will be up to par. However, they couldn’t be more wrong! 


Currently, multicultural consumers represent almost half (40%) of the total population, yet Multicultural Media investments comprise only
5.2% of total advertising and marketing spend. With so many brands and businesses neglecting to make an effort to connect with them, businesses who do take the extra step can tap into reaching these audiences and reap the rewards. 


The
ANA’s AIMM Cultural Insights Impact Measure found that consumers who perceive ads as “culturally relevant” are a staggering  2.6 times more likely to find the brand relevant to them, and are 2.7 times more likely to purchase a brand for the first time. Plus, these consumers are 50% more likely to repurchase a brand they have bought in the past.

9. Establish Trust by Communicating with Customers Online


In addition to updating your website, checking up and responding to Google and Yelp reviews can be a key component of how customers and potential customers view your business. 


According to consumers, businesses that respond to reviews are seen as
1.7X more trustworthy than businesses that don't, so it’s worth taking the time to respond to these reviews -- whether they’re good or bad -- to put consumers at ease.


According to Google Small Business, responding to good reviews can be as simple as saying thank you. However, when responding to negative reviews, it can be helpful to
keep the following tips in mind: 


  • Respond in a timely manner --  customers will appreciate this.
  • Stay professional and courteous and remember not to take the review personally.
  • Understand your customer’s experience before responding. If someone mentions an issue with a product or service, try to see what may have gone wrong and be honest about mistakes made and the steps you’ve taken or plan to take to fix the situation.
  • Apologize when appropriate to show compassion for the customer.
  • Offer to talk it out. If this is the first you’re hearing of their complaint, invite them to discuss it via email or call so that you can try to sort out the matter.
  • Show that you’re authentic and genuine. Sign off using your name or initials to show you’re taking it seriously and that there’s a real person behind your business.
